www.DataSheet4U.com VTM VI Chip – VTM Voltage Transformation Module TM V048K015T090 K indicates BGA configuration. For other mounting options see Part Numbering below. 48 V to 1.5 V VI Chip Converter 90 A (135 A for 1 ms) High density – 360 A/in 3 125°C operation 1 µs transient response >3.5 million hours MTBF Typical efficiency 93% at 1.5 V/50 A No output filtering required BGA or J-Lead packages Actual size © Vf = 26 - 55 V VOUT = 0.8 - 1.7 V IOUT = 90 A K = 1/32 ROUT = 1.2 mΩ max Small footprint – 84 A/in2 Low weight – 0.5 oz (14 g) Pick & Place / SMD Product Description Absolute Maximum Ratings Parameter +In to -In +In to -In PC to -In TM to -In VC to -In +Out to -Out Isolation voltage The V048K015T090 VI Chip Voltage Transformation Module (VTM) breaks records for speed, density and efficiency to meet the demands of advanced DSP, FPGA, ASIC, processor cores and microprocessor applications at the point of load (POL) while providing isolation from input to output. It achieves a response time of less than 1 µs and delivers up to 90 A in a volume of less than 0.25 in3 while providing low output voltages with unprecedented efficiency. It may be paralleled to deliver hundreds of amps at an output voltage settable from 0.8 to 1.7 Vdc.
